Holy heck it's steamy. Who knew that I would fall in love with a cowboy romance, and I need more immediately! This was almost a DNF for me, only because it took close to 200 pages to get to the action but once it does, it doesn't stop! Elsie Silver does an amazing job at creating a tasteful workplace romance. 

The plot centers around Rhett Eaton professional bull rider with a bad reputation, in hopes of clearing his name (and brand deals) his agent assigns him a babysitter for the last leg of his tour, Summer Hamilton. The only issue? Summer just so happens to be the daughter of his agent. I loved the banter between the two main characters, Summer was so sassy and really stood her ground when it came to Rhett. Immediately the connection and banter between the two of them was spot on, not only that, Summer fit right in with the Eaton family. 

What really brought it all together, was the fact that it wasn't just some fluffy romance. The fear of Rhett not knowing if he would be able to continue his legacy with his injuries really got to me, and hearing about Summer's history broke my heart. These two characters really needed each other, and it seems they both came into each others lives at the right moment.
